Cantor Fitzgerald Establishes Presence in Ireland with Acquisition
of Dolmen Stockbrokers
NEW YORK and DUBLIN, Dec. 3,
2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Cantor Fitzgerald, a leading
global financial services firm, today announced that it has
acquired Dolmen Stockbrokers, one of the largest independent
stockbrokers in Ireland. The transaction expands Cantor's
capacity to provide sales and trading, research and advisory
services to clients in Ireland as
part of the continued growth of its global capital markets
franchise. Serving clients in the Irish marketplace through
offices in Dublin, Cork and Limerick, Dolmen's team of 90
seasoned professionals will continue to be led by Ronan Reid, who will serve as Chief Executive
Officer of Cantor Fitzgerald Ireland and stockbroking division,
Dolmen Stockbrokers, a part of Cantor Fitzgerald Ireland.

Cantor Fitzgerald Ireland will provide institutional, corporate
and retail clients in Ireland with
access to the firm's global distribution platform and breadth of
financial products, while focusing on growing Cantor's client base
in the region. Cantor Fitzgerald Ireland will offer clients
institutional bond and equity market trading and dealing,
investment banking services, retail stock broking, currency
broking, sale of structured products, discretionary wealth
management and pension services. In addition, the firm will
provide management and advisory services, and expand the range of
brokerage services to clients.

Cantor Fitzgerald received regulatory approval for the
transaction from the Central Bank of Ireland.
About Cantor Fitzgerald
Cantor Fitzgerald, a premier global financial services firm at the
forefront of financial and technological innovation, has been a
proven and resilient leader for over 65 years. Cantor is a
preeminent capital markets investment bank serving more than 5,000
institutional clients around the world in institutional equity and
fixed income sales and trading and is recognized for its
strengths serving the middle market with investment banking
services, prime brokerage, and commercial real estate financing.
Cantor Fitzgerald also is a leader in new businesses including
advisory and asset management services, gaming technology,
e-commerce, and other ventures. Cantor Fitzgerald & Co. is one
of 21 primary dealers authorized to trade U.S. government
securities with The Federal Reserve Bank of New York. Cantor Fitzgerald's 1,600 employees
serve clients through over 30 locations, including major financial
centers around the world in the Americas, Europe, Asia/Pacific, and the Middle East. For more information please visit
